正文
js中的eval,js中的event对象
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
如何执行字符串形式的js代码
1、第一种方式 var str= var sum = 1 + 2 ;eval(str);alert(sum)第二种方法 把方法写入到a页面中,b页面中直接调用。如 a 页面中提交到b页面。
2、有两个参数。 第一个参数,旧的字符。 第二个参数,新的字符。 不会修改原数组。 会将替换好的数组以返回值的形式返回出来。 如果旧的字符在字符串中不止一个,则替换第一个。不会改变原数组。
3、方案只有一种:通过eval方式把字符串转换为命令方式,执行字符串型方法函数。
4、传入参数是起始位置和结束位置。 \x0d\x0areplace() _ \x0d\x0a用来查找匹配一个正则表达式的字符串,然后使用新字符串代替匹配的字符串。 \x0d\x0asearch() _ \x0d\x0a执行一个正则表达式匹配查找。
5、encodeURI()把字符串编码为 URI encodeURIComponent()把字符串编码为 URI 组件 escape()对字符串进行编码 上面是查询来自w3school的资料。那么三者之间有什么区别呢,请容我测试测试。
6、要创建一个字符串对象,可使用如下语句:var strObj = new String(Hello, String!);使用typeof运算符查看会发现,上面的myStr类型为string,而strObj类型为object。如果想知道字符串的长度,使用其length属性:string.length。
javascript中eval的用法
1、eval() 函数作用是可以接受一个字符串str作为参数,并把这个参数作为脚本代码来执行。如果参数是一个表达式,eval() 函数将执行表达式; 如果参数是Javascript语句,eval()将执行 Javascript 语句。
2、Eval函数在JavaScript脚步语言中的使用:新建一网页文件“a.html”,在文件中输入如图所示代码并保存,打开该网页文件使脚本运行,则输入结果如图。
3、参数:string,描述:要计算的字符串,其中含有要计算的Javascript表达式或要执行的语句。jscript中的用法很相似。Eval函数 eva函数允许动态执行JScript源代码。
4、例如,在Ruby中,eval方法用于解析和执行一个字符串作为Ruby代码。因此,在实际应用中,需要小心使用eval函数,并确保对输入进行适当的验证和过滤,以防止潜在的安全漏洞。
5、用法:Eval(codeString)codeString是包含有Javascript语句的字符串,在eval之后使用Javascript引擎编译。
javascript的eval函数的优点是什么?只知道是将括号内的字符串当JS语句...
eval可以将字符串生成语句执行,一般执行动态的js语句。eval的使用场合:有时候我们预先不知道要执行什么语句,只有当条件和参数给时才知道执行什么语句,这时候eval就派上用场了。
eval()函数的作用是将字符串当作Python代码执行。它会动态地解析并执行字符串中的Python表达式或语句。字符串求值 `eval()`函数主要用于字符串的求值。
作用是把对应的字符串解析成js代码并运行。eval()是程序语言中的函数,功能是获取返回值,不同语言大同小异,函数基础是返回值= eval(codeString),如果eval函数在执行时遇到错误,则抛出异常给调用者。
eval() 函数作用是可以接受一个字符串str作为参数,并把这个参数作为脚本代码来执行。如果参数是一个表达式,eval() 函数将执行表达式; 如果参数是Javascript语句,eval()将执行 Javascript 语句。
expression:要求值的表达式,可以是变量、函数调用、运算符和其他Python语法元素。globals:指定全局命名空间,默认为当前的命名空间。locals:指定局部命名空间,默认为None。
js中的eval的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于js中的event对象、js中的eval的信息别忘了在本站进行查找喔。